Here are the 10 good reasons why you should not buy a car, which I discovered after I sold mine. It is not that bad afterall (sounds like sour grapes :) !

1) Exercise more by walking. Duke University Medical Center found that a brisk 30 minute walk 6 days a week is enough to trim waistlines and cut the risk of metabolic syndrome.

2) Contribute to save Mother Earth – reduce carbon dioxide emission by 120kgC/day.

3) Save more money. I can now free up about $900/mth for savings, investments and other needs/wants.

4) Read more books. With others driving me around, I can read books during the journeys and write more book summaries here!

5) No traffic jams. I usually take train now which is not affected by heavy road traffic. I was driving a manual transmission so it made traffic jam even more unbearable.

6) No queuing or waiting for carpark space. I no longer need to consider the ease of parking when going to places. In crowded location, parking is really a pain, you can wait up to 1 hour!

7) No carpark charges. Parking in city area can be very expensive and always had to limit the time spent at the place.

8) No fines. Sometimes when there is no carpark spaces, I had to illegal park the car and expose myself to the possibility of getting a ticket.

9) No pumping of petrol. Petrol prices have been soaring and it hurts the wallet especially if the car has bad fuel consumption.

10) No maintenance. I no longer need to schedule car maintenance and pay hefty repair/replacement fees.
